SARATOGA SPRINGS — Pallet, a female-focused coworking community, in support of two of its members who met at their Saratoga Springs location, is now partnering to address the nationwide baby formula shortage.
Christine Hernandez who owns Allo Saratoga and Dr. Jennifer Lefner who founded Seedlings Baby Food LLC will be hosting a free formula and diaper exchange every Sunday afternoon starting on May 22.
These inspiring female entrepreneurs and experts in childcare are stepping up to help local parents find relief and feed their babies. This exchange will run as long as it is needed.
The exchange will be Sunday’s from 2 to 4 p.m. at Allo Saratoga located at 25 Lawrence St., Suite 1A, Saratoga Springs.
